ISLAMABAD: Pakistan Muslim League-Nawaz (PML-N) Federal Minister Malik Ahmed Khan came down hard upon the top court, saying that the Supreme Court (SC) played the role of superintendent in Panama Papers case.
The PML-N leader also raised questions over composition of benches of the top court for hearing of the cases. He said the top court rewrote the Constitution while taking up the matter related to Article 63-A of the Constitution as interpretation of their own choice was done.
“The injustice is being committed again and again,” said the federal minister while addressing a press conference in Islamabad.
“You erred in interpretation of Article 63-A of the Constitution,” said the minister.
Malik Ahmed Khan said that the incumbent chief justice admitted that he had relations with Mian Saqib Nisar
“We know they [PTI} want to get the elections conducted in Punjab and wanted to create hegemony. This is what you are doing and this is part of the conspiracy,” said Malik Ahmed Khan, adding that Imran Khan had the facilitators for a long time.
“The facilitators wanted to fix Nawaz Sharif under the leadership of Mian Saqib Nisar. There is still reflection of that mindset,” said the PML-N.
He stated that the judges needed to give verdicts under the law and the Constitution and on the basis of the evidence, regretting that the decisions were being given against his party’s leadership despite the lack of evidence.
